Default Got a OEM wrinkle wlack outer primary cover? Question for ya!

My bike came with a chrome outer primary so I can't tell for myself....

I picked up a powdercoated (wrinkle black) outer cover from eBay and the grooves/recesses where the derby and inspection covers seat are covered in PC. There is no overspray on the threads, inside, or inner cover mating face and the finish is perfect. This doesn't seem to be a case of sloppy work, but I also can't imagine the cover gaskets sealing properly on that wrinkle texture.

Should I clean the PC off of those areas?

Any work I've ever done with PC parts, especially when gaskets are involved, I've had to remove the powder coat. I'd say tape off the areas that you want to keep PC, then use a combination of 80/200/500 sandpaper to bring it back to metal.
